Intervention Cereals


Cereal crop


The purpose of the Intervention Cereals scheme is to:

  • purchase barley from offerers during the buying-season (currently 1 November to 31 May);
  • store the cereals on behalf of the Community; and
  • sell intervention cereals stocks when the Commission agrees to release them onto the market ensuring all appropriate end-use requirements are met.
